Okay, so I was super hyped to jump into Wuthering Waves, right? I pre-downloaded it through the Epic Games Launcher, thinking I’d be all set to go when it launched. But nope, that was not the case.
The Problem Started
When the launch time hit, I clicked that “Play” button in the Epic Games Launcher, and… nothing. Well, not exactly nothing. The button changed to “Running,” but the game itself? Nowhere to be seen. I waited, thinking maybe it was just a slow start. Still nothing.

Troubleshooting Attempts
First thing I did was the classic “turn it off and on again.” I restarted the Epic Games Launcher. No change. Then, I restarted my whole computer. Still no Wuthering Waves.
Next, I figured maybe there was a problem with the installation. So, I went into the Epic Games Launcher and found the “Verify” option for Wuthering Waves. I clicked that, it did its thing, and… still no luck. The game just wouldn’t start.
- Restarted Epic Games Launcher.
- Restarted my computer.
- Verified the game files.
I was getting pretty frustrated at this point. After that, I tried running Epic Games Launcher as administrator. That method does work, but it is time consuming.
The Simple Fix
Finally, I found that I can find the wuthering waves game folder, and lauch the game by click the luncher in game folder directly, It works!
I don’t know what is wrong with Epic Games, so I choose play this game by opening the game launcher, I can start enjoy the game now.
